Default Marsha McCloskey's feathered star patterns

Does anyone know if all of Marsha McCloskey's feathered star patterns are paper pieced? I love paper piecing, but not crazy about making 1 inch HST or Y-seams. I'd like to order one of her books, but I'd like to make sure of the method before I do. TIA.

agreed. i got her books in early 90's before the paper pieced fad. she gives excellent, clear instruction & tips for accurate piecing via machine. all patterns can be converted to paper piece technique & pp patterns can be converted to simple piecing ...directions for converting to paper piecing can be found on carol doaks website plus free patterns to practice & learn technique.

I've taken two workshops from Marsha McCloskey. One of them was five days and the other was two days. She taught us how to draft our blocks. I loved her instruction. She is my favorite teacher.

She is all about precision piecing, not paper piecing. She did mention that others use paper piecing, but not her.
